Western Blot Analysis of Apoptosis Markers

Total protein was extracted from the cells subjected to the different treatments using RIPA buffer (Beyotime Institute of Biotechnology) at 4℃. After resolution of the total proteins by electrophoresis, the protein bands were electrotransferred to polyvinylidene difluoride membranes for incubation with primary antibodies against the following target proteins: GAPDH (1:5000 dilution, ab8245, Abcam), caspase‐3 (1:1000, ab4051, Abcam), caspase‐9 (1:1000, ab25758, Abcam), cleaved caspase‐3 (1:1000, ab2302, Abcam), cleaved caspase‐9 (1:1000, ab2324, Abcam), Src homology region 2 domain‐containing phosphatase 1 (SHP‐1) (1:2000, ab227503, Abcam), signal transducer and activator of transcription 3 (STAT3) (1:2500, ab31370, Abcam), and phosphor STAT3 (1:500, ab7315, Abcam). Thereafter, the membranes were incubated with goat anti‐rat secondary antibody (1:1000, A0216, Beyotime Institute of Biotechnology) and horseradish peroxidase‐conjugated goat anti‐rabbit antibody (1:1000; A0208, Beyotime Institute of Biotechnology). The immune response zone was finally detected by development with a microporous chemiluminescence western blot kit (Millipore Sigma).

Western Blot Analysis of JAK2/STAT3 Signaling

Total protein of cells was extracted using high-efficiency RIPA lysis buffer (R0010, Beijing Solarbio Science & Technology Co., Ltd., Beijing, China) in strict accordance with the instructions. The protein concentration was determined using a BCA kit (20201 ES76, Yeasen Company, Shanghai, China). Then, the protein was separated by polyacrylamide gel electrophoresis and then transferred to PVDF membranes by wet transfer method. Next, the membranes were blocked using 5% BSA at room temperature for 1 h and probed overnight at 4 °C with the following diluted primary antibodies: mouse anti-human GAPDH (ab9425, 1:2500, Abcam, Cambridge, UK), JAK2 (ab39636, 1:1000, Abcam, Cambridge, UK), p-JAK2 (ab195055, 1:1000, Abcam, Cambridge, UK), STAT3 (ab31370, 1:500, Abcam, Cambridge, UK), and p-STAT3 (ab86430, 1:500, Abcam, Cambridge, UK). The membranes were washed for three times (5 min/time) with Tris-buffered saline Tween-20 (TBST), and horseradish peroxidase (HRP)-labeled goat anti-rabbit immunoglobulin G (IgG) (ab205718, 1:20,000, Abcam, Cambridge, UK) was added for 1 h of incubation at room temperature. Then, ImageJ 1.48u software (National Institutes of Health) was performed for protein quantification analysis. The ratio of the gray value of the target band to GAPDH was representative of the relative protein expression. The experiment was repeated three times.

Western Blotting of Apoptosis Markers

Extracts of cells and specimens were prepared in RIPA buffer (Beyotime Biotechnology) at 4 °C. WB was performed with the cell extracts using commercially available primary antibodies. Primary antibodies used in this study includes: Antibodies to GAPDH (1:5000, ab8245, Abcam), Caspase-3 (1:1000, ab4051, Abcam), Caspase-9 (1:1000, ab25758, Abcam), cleaved Caspase-3 (1:1000, ab2302, Abcam), cleaved Caspase-9 (1:1000, ab2324, Abcam), SHP-1 (1:2000, AB227503, Abcam), STAT3 (1:2500, ab31370, Abcam), and phosphor STAT3 (1:500, ab7315, Abcam). A combination of horseradish peroxidase-conjugated goat anti-rabbit (1:1,000; A0208) and goat anti-mouse secondary antibodies (1:1000; A0216, all from Beyotime Biotechnology) were used to detect the immunoreactive bands; development was performed using the Millipore chromogenic chemiluminescence detection kit (Millipore Sigma, Burlington, MA).

Protein Expression Analysis in Bladder Cancer

Total proteins in cultured bladder cancer cells were prepared by lysis using the Cell Total Protein Lysis kit (Sangon Biotech, Shanghai, China), following the producer’s instructions. The protein concentration was detected using the BCA method. Then, the protein was boiled at 100 °C for 5 min, separated by sodium dodecyl sulfate–polyacrylamide gel electrophoresis, and transferred onto a polyvinylidene fluoride (PVDF) membrane pre-immersed with methanol. Following blocking in 5% bovine serum albumin solution for 2 h at room temperature, PVDF membranes were incubated with primary antibodies at 4 °C overnight and with secondary antibodies for 1–2 h at room temperature. The relative protein levels were finally detected by development with enhanced ECL substrate solutions (#32106; Thermo Fisher Scientific). The bands were observed using Tanon-5200CE (Biotanon, Shanghai, China). The expression of GAPDH protein was simultaneously analyzed as the internal standard for non-phosphorylation proteins. Primary antibodies used in Western blotting include anti-ITGA2 (#BM5058; Boster; 1:1000), anti-p-AKT (#4060S; CST; 1:1000), anti-AKT (#2920S; CST; 1:1000), anti-p-p65 (#3033S; CST; 1:1000), anti-p65 (#ab7970; Abcam; 1:1000), anti-p-STAT3 (#9145; CST: 1:1000), anti-STAT3 (#ab31370; Abcam; 1:1000), and anti-GAPDH (#60004-1-Ig; Proteintech; 1:1000).
